欢迎访问 生活随笔!

生活随笔

当前位置: 首页 > 编程资源 > 编程问答 >内容正文

编程问答

matplotlib-pie-绘制饼状图

发布时间:2025/4/5 编程问答 47 豆豆
生活随笔 收集整理的这篇文章主要介绍了 matplotlib-pie-绘制饼状图 小编觉得挺不错的,现在分享给大家,帮大家做个参考.
import matplotlib.pyplot as pltplt.figure(figsize=(6,9)) #调节图形大小 labels = ['A','B','C','D'] #定义标签 sizes = [146,223,121,68] #每块值 colors = ['red','yellowgreen','lightskyblue','yellow'] #每块颜色定义 explode = (0,0,0.1,0) #将某一块分割出来,值越大分割出的间隙越大#patches饼图的返回值,texts1饼图外label的文本,texts2饼图内部文本 patches,text1,text2 = plt.pie(sizes,explode=explode,labels=labels,colors=colors,labeldistance = 1.1, #标签距圆心半径倍距离autopct = '%3.2f%%', #数值保留固定小数位shadow = True, #阴影设置startangle =90, #逆时针起始角度设置pctdistance = 0.5) #数值距圆心半径倍数距离# x,y轴刻度设置一致,保证饼图为圆形 plt.axis('equal') plt.legend() plt.show()

总结

以上是生活随笔为你收集整理的matplotlib-pie-绘制饼状图的全部内容,希望文章能够帮你解决所遇到的问题。

如果觉得生活随笔网站内容还不错,欢迎将生活随笔推荐给好友。